dev-lang/ghc: add dependency on ncurses-5 ABI for ghc[binary], bug #603632
all existing GHC versions were built agains ncurses-5.
Pull in this binary depend when uses choses to install
ghc binary as-is.

diff --git a/dev-lang/ghc/ghc-7.10.2-r1.ebuild b/dev-lang/ghc/ghc-7.10.2-r1.ebuild
index c010b36..13af9a4 100644
--- a/dev-lang/ghc/ghc-7.10.2-r1.ebuild
+++ b/dev-lang/ghc/ghc-7.10.2-r1.ebuild
@@ -1,4 +1,4 @@
-# Copyright 1999-2015 Gentoo Foundation
+# Copyright 1999-2016 Gentoo Foundation
# Distributed under the terms of the GNU General Public License v2
# $Id$
@@ -90,6 +90,15 @@ RDEPEND="
kernel_linux? ( >=sys-devel/binutils-2.17:* )
kernel_SunOS? ( >=sys-devel/binutils-2.17:* )
"
+# gentoo binaries are built against ncurses-5
+RDEPEND+="
+ binary? (
+ || (
+ sys-libs/ncurses:0/5
+ sys-libs/ncurses:5/5
+ )
+ )
+"
# force dependency on >=gmp-5, even if >=gmp-4.1 would be enough. this is due to
# that we want the binaries to use the latest versioun available, and not to be
